The Atlanta Hawks look for a 10th straight win as they host another streaking side, the Orlando Magic, who have reeled off seven straight Ws.

Atlanta’s defense has been dominant during this run, and with Orlando down a key piece, my Magic vs Hawks predictions and free NBA picks have the home team running their win streak to double digits on Monday, March 16.

Magic vs Hawks prediction

Magic vs Hawks best bet: Hawks moneyline (-135)

The Atlanta Hawks' nine-game win streak has been fueled by a defense allowing just 104 points per game, which is No. 2 in the NBA.

Four times during this run, they’ve held an opponent to less than 100 points.

The Orlando Magic have been far more offensive-minded during their seven-game fun run, averaging 125 points per game, the third-most in the league, and almost 10 points better than their season average.

Against a top-flight defense, though, they need more offensive table-setters, and Franz Wagner is out. That’s enough to tilt the court Atlanta’s way.

Eric has been involved in sports media in many different capacities since graduating from journalism school in 1999, back when getting your own column in a newspaper was still considered a thing. He doubled down and graduated from broadcast journalism school five years later, which led to a move to Toronto and a career with The Sports Network (TSN). From behind-the-scenes production work, he moved into the digital realm, where he had his own hoops column (At the Buzzer), while regularly live streaming and chatting with fans during broadcasts as the character known as LeBlog James. He was also a key contributor to TSN and CTV’s Olympic programming during the 2012 London Games.

Eric eventually found his way into the sports betting field in 2016 and has been a mainstay ever since. He was tagged on Twitter as a Top 10 NBA sharp during the 2021 season and has been interviewed about basketball and his handicapping process on shows from Vancouver to India. Eric is now a jack-of-all-sports at Covers, where his predictions span the alphabet soup: NFL, NBA, MLB, NHL, F1, WNBA, Euro, and Copa.

When making picks, he focuses on finding value first and foremost, and ensuring readers have all the information they need to make an informed choice.
